某铀矿石微生物浸铀粒度试验

摘要: 以某铀矿石为研究对象,对比了粒度为5.0~0.1 mm,10~0.1 mm,15~0.1 mm的铀矿石在相同条件下的微生物浸铀效果。通过对比总浸出率、总酸耗、泥化与结垢等确定了理想的微生物浸铀粒度。结果表明,3种试样均能取得90%以上的浸出率,10~0.1 mm试样经济技术指标最优。

Abstract: Taking a uranium ore as research target, animalcule leaching uranium effect of uranium ore with particle size 5.0~0.1 mm,10~0.1 mm,15~0.1 mm at the same condition were compared. Ideal animalcule leaching uranium particle size were confirmed after comparison of general leaching rate, general acid consumption, sludging and scaling and so on. Result indicated these three samples all could obtain leaching rate of over 90%,economic and technical indexes of sample 10~0.1mm were the best.
